[0001] The application belongs to the technical field of wind power generation, and particularly relates to an index statistical method and system for annual inspection quality analysis of a wind turbine. BACKGROUND
[0002] In the field of wind power generation, regular annual inspection of wind turbines is a key link to ensure their long-term stable operation and improve safety and efficiency. Traditionally, the quality analysis of wind turbine annual inspection highly depends on the experience and intuition of engineers, and this process involves a lot of manual data collection, sorting and analysis work. Although manual analysis can capture the operating conditions of the wind turbine to some extent, this method has significant limitations, mainly in the following aspects: first, manual on-site inspection often fails to obtain all the key parameters of wind turbine operation in real time and comprehensively, which may lead to biased analysis results, thus there is a problem of incompleteness of data collection, second, manually recorded data may have errors, such as inaccurate recording or omission of important information, which affects the accuracy of subsequent analysis, resulting in uncontrollable data quality. Differences in experience and personal judgment of engineers may affect the assessment of the health status of the wind turbine, leading to poor consistency of analysis results, and there is a problem of subjectivity in data analysis. In addition, the traditional method focuses on post-analysis and lacks the ability to provide early warning for future possible faults, which limits the effectiveness of preventive maintenance and results in a lack of fault prediction capability. Manual preparation of maintenance reports is not only time-consuming but also prone to errors, which is not conducive to efficient management and decision-making, and there is a problem of low efficiency in report generation.
[0003] In summary, the existing technology has problems such as low efficiency, insufficient accuracy and lack of foresight in the quality analysis of wind turbine annual inspection, and there is an urgent need for a more systematic and intelligent method and technology to overcome these shortcomings. [0004] The purpose of the present application is to provide an index statistical method and system for quality analysis of wind turbine annual inspection to solve the problems of low efficiency, insufficient accuracy and lack of foresight in the quality analysis of wind turbine annual inspection in the prior art.
[0005] In order to achieve the above-mentioned purpose, the technical scheme adopted by the present application is as follows: In a first aspect, the present application provides an index statistical method for quality analysis of wind turbine annual inspection, comprising: obtaining wind turbine annual operation data; calculating fault operation duration and fault-free operation duration according to the wind turbine annual operation data, and counting fault occurrence frequency; generating a wind turbine inspection quality analysis report based on the fault operation duration, the fault-free operation duration and the fault occurrence frequency.
[0006] Preferably, the obtaining the annual operation data of the fan specifically comprises: obtaining the number of annual inspection work tickets of the fan, the operation execution time of each annual inspection work ticket, the reemployment time and the fault data.
[0007] Preferably, the fault operation duration and the fault-free operation duration are calculated according to the operation execution time and the reemployment time of each annual inspection work ticket, and the fault occurrence frequency is counted.
[0008] Preferably, the fault operation duration and the fault-free operation duration are calculated according to the operation execution time and the reemployment time of each annual inspection work ticket, and the fault occurrence frequency is counted, specifically comprising: taking the safety measure execution time of the first work ticket as the starting point and the reemployment time of the last work ticket as the ending point to construct an annual inspection time interval; taking the first 1 / 3 month before the regular inspection to the first 1 / 3 month after the regular inspection as a comparison time window; calculating the fault operation duration according to the operation execution time and the reemployment time of each annual inspection work ticket; calculating the fault-free operation duration according to the number of annual inspection work tickets and the fault operation duration; counting the fault frequency in the time window according to the operation execution time of each annual inspection work ticket and the comparison time window.

[0022] In some embodiments, the obtaining the annual operation data of the wind turbine specifically includes: obtaining the number of annual inspection work tickets of the wind turbine, the operation error execution time of each annual inspection work ticket, the re-commissioning time, and the fault data. In terms of technology, this step requires the data acquisition system of the wind farm to record and store the maintenance and fault information of the wind turbine in real time, ensuring the completeness and accuracy of the data; in terms of principle, the maintenance cycle and maintenance duration of the wind turbine can be determined through the operation error execution time and the re-commissioning time of each annual inspection work ticket, and then the efficiency and quality of the maintenance work can be evaluated; in terms of effect, the collected fault data can reveal the health status of the wind turbine, providing a basis for the calculation of the fault operation duration and the fault-free operation duration. In other embodiments, additional sensors can also be installed to monitor the status of key components of the wind turbine, collecting more comprehensive operation data to improve the accuracy of fault prediction.
[0023] In some embodiments, the fault operation duration and the fault-free operation duration are calculated according to the operation error execution time and the re-commissioning time of each annual inspection work ticket, and the fault occurrence frequency is counted. In terms of technology, this process involves time series analysis and data cleaning to ensure the reliability and effectiveness of the calculation results; in terms of principle, by comparing the time points before and after the execution of each work ticket, the running state of the wind turbine during and after maintenance can be accurately calculated, and thus the fault operation duration and the fault-free operation duration can be obtained; in terms of effect, the counted fault frequency can reflect the failure rate of the wind turbine, helping the wind farm manager to evaluate the reliability of the wind turbine. In other embodiments, a prediction model of the wind turbine state can also be established to predict possible faults in advance, reduce unplanned downtime, and further optimize the operation efficiency of the wind turbine.
[0024] In some embodiments, the fault operation duration and the fault-free operation duration are calculated according to the operation error execution time and the re-commissioning time of each annual inspection work ticket, specifically including: taking the safety measure execution time of the first work ticket as the starting point and the re-commissioning time of the last work ticket as the ending point to construct the annual inspection time interval; taking the first 1 / 3 month before the regular inspection to the first 1 / 3 month after the regular inspection as the comparison time window. In terms of technology, this implementation utilizes the concept of time window to compare data within a specific time range, improving the relevance and practicality of the analysis; in terms of principle, by calculating the fault operation duration and the fault-free operation duration within the annual inspection time interval, the running performance of the wind turbine during the maintenance cycle can be evaluated; in terms of effect, the setting of the comparison time window helps to analyze the performance recovery of the wind turbine after maintenance, providing a basis for adjusting the maintenance strategy. In other embodiments, the length of the comparison time window can also be dynamically adjusted according to the type of the wind turbine and the operating environment, to adapt to different analysis needs.
